010 | Nick Jones
Marine Raider. Veteran. Recipient of the Navy Cross, Navy and Marine Corps Commendation Medal for Valor, and a Purple Heart. President and Founder of Talons Reach Foundation. Nick Jones served honorably in the United States Marine Corps for 12 years, including three combat deployments and five deployments total. Following injuries sustained in 2020, Nick underwent six major surgeries in the span of a year and a half. After medically retiring from the Marine Corps, Nick continues his commitment to Special Operations Forces through Talons Reach, giving these warriors an opportunity to find sanctuary, mindfulness, and access to the tools and resources necessary to accelerate their path to recovery.
